Funzione D2D1GetGradientMeshInteriorPointsFromCoonsPatch (d2d1_3.h)

Restituisce i punti interni per una patch mesh sfumata in base ai punti che definiscono una patch cooni.

Nota  

Questa funzione viene chiamata dalla funzione GradientMeshPatchFromCoonsPatch e non deve essere usata direttamente.

 

Sintassi

void D2D1GetGradientMeshInteriorPointsFromCoonsPatch(
  [in]  const D2D1_POINT_2F *pPoint0,
  [in]  const D2D1_POINT_2F *pPoint1,
  [in]  const D2D1_POINT_2F *pPoint2,
  [in]  const D2D1_POINT_2F *pPoint3,
  [in]  const D2D1_POINT_2F *pPoint4,
  [in]  const D2D1_POINT_2F *pPoint5,
  [in]  const D2D1_POINT_2F *pPoint6,
  [in]  const D2D1_POINT_2F *pPoint7,
  [in]  const D2D1_POINT_2F *pPoint8,
  [in]  const D2D1_POINT_2F *pPoint9,
  [in]  const D2D1_POINT_2F *pPoint10,
  [in]  const D2D1_POINT_2F *pPoint11,
  [out] D2D1_POINT_2F       *pTensorPoint11,
  [out] D2D1_POINT_2F       *pTensorPoint12,
  [out] D2D1_POINT_2F       *pTensorPoint21,
  [out] D2D1_POINT_2F       *pTensorPoint22
);

Parametri

[in] pPoint0

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 0.

[in] pPoint1

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 1.

[in] pPoint2

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 2.

[in] pPoint3

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 3.

[in] pPoint4

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 4.

[in] pPoint5

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 5.

[in] pPoint6

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 6.

[in] pPoint7

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 7.

[in] pPoint8

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 8.

[in] pPoint9

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 9.

[in] pPoint10

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 10.

[in] pPoint11

Tipo: D2D1_POINT_2F*

Posizione dello spazio delle coordinate del punto di controllo nella posizione 11.

[out] pTensorPoint11

Tipo: D2D1_POINT_2F*

Restituisce il punto interno per la mesh sfumata corrispondente a point11 nella struttura D2D1_GRADIENT_MESH_PATCH .

[out] pTensorPoint12

Tipo: D2D1_POINT_2F*

Restituisce il punto interno per la mesh sfumata corrispondente al punto12 nella struttura D2D1_GRADIENT_MESH_PATCH .

[out] pTensorPoint21

Tipo: D2D1_POINT_2F*

Restituisce il punto interno per la mesh sfumata corrispondente a point21 nella struttura D2D1_GRADIENT_MESH_PATCH .

[out] pTensorPoint22

Tipo: D2D1_POINT_2F*

Restituisce il punto interno per la mesh sfumata corrispondente a point22 nella struttura D2D1_GRADIENT_MESH_PATCH .

Valore restituito

nessuno

Osservazioni

Questa funzione viene chiamata dalla funzione GradientMeshPatchFromCoonsPatch e non deve essere usata direttamente.

Requisiti

   
Client minimo supportato Windows 10 [app desktop | App UWP]
Server minimo supportato Windows Server 2016 [app desktop | App UWP]
Piattaforma di destinazione Windows
Intestazione d2d1_3.h
Libreria D2d1.lib
DLL D2d1.dll